Ii. Key Technological Advantages
Materials Science and Precision Machining
Core component strengthening
The plunger pair is made of GCr15 bearing steel (containing 1.5% chromium), which has undergone superfinishing grinding (surface roughness Ra≤0.05μm) and ion nitriding treatment. Its hardness reaches HV1000, and its resistance to fuel erosion and wear is enhanced by 50%, making it suitable for harsh fuel environments with sulfur content > 1%.
The pump body is made of QT600-3 ductile iron (with a tensile strength of 600MPa), and has undergone aging treatment to eliminate internal stress. Its high-pressure deformation resistance has been enhanced by 40%, and it can withstand an instantaneous pressure of 2500bar without leakage.
Sealing technology upgrade
It adopts double helix sealing rings (PTFE material), with the friction coefficient reduced to 0.05, and the leakage rate ≤0.1mL/min (industry standard ≤0.3mL/min), reducing fuel consumption and environmental pollution.
The bearing housing integrates a labyrinth dust-proof design, blocking over 99% of dust particles and extending the bearing life to more than 20,000 hours.
Intelligent control and pressure management
Electronically controlled common rail technology: Equipped with high-precision pressure sensors working in coordination with the ECU, it can dynamically adjust the fuel delivery volume in real time (response time < 5ms), meeting the strict limits on nitrogen oxides (NOx) stipulated in the National IV/Stage V emission standards.
Low-pressure pre-supply system: Integrated pre-supply oil pump (with an oil delivery capacity of 50L/h), it can quickly establish oil pressure during cold start (< 10 seconds), solving the problem of oil supply delay in low-temperature environments, and increasing the start-up success rate to over 99%.
Original factory-level compatibility and reliability
Strictly follow the fuel system design parameters of Perkins 1200/1500 series engines:
The installation interface is perfectly matched with the engine block and high-pressure oil pipe (with a bolt hole spacing tolerance of ±0.1mm), and can be installed without additional calibration.
It forms a system-level compatibility with the original factory fuel injectors (such as 131406490) and fuel filters (such as 4181A025), ensuring precise coordination of fuel injection timing and fuel quantity, and reducing the risk of failure caused by compatibility issues.

Iv. Installation and Maintenance Suggestions
Installation specifications
Cleaning and pretreatment: Before installation, flush the entire fuel line with Perkins' dedicated fuel cleaner (P-0034) to ensure there are no iron filings or gum residues (it is recommended to use a 10μm precision filter screen for filtration).
Torque control: The high-pressure oil pipe interface adopts double conical surface sealing. Use a torque wrench to tighten it according to the original factory standard (35±2N · m) to avoid high-pressure fuel leakage caused by poor sealing.
Timing calibration: Calibrate the phase of the oil pump camshaft through dedicated tools (such as Perkins PT-200 diagnostic instrument) to ensure that the timing deviation from the crankshaft is less than ±0.5°, avoiding incorrect fuel injection timing.
Daily maintenance
Pressure monitoring: During each maintenance, the rail pressure is detected through the fuel pressure gauge (standard value: 2000±50bar). If there is any abnormal fluctuation, it is necessary to check for filter element blockage or pump body wear.
Fuel management: Use Perkins original fuel (sulfur content ≤0.05%). Test the water content of the fuel every 500 hours (drain when it exceeds 0.5%) to prevent plunger rusting caused by moisture.
Visual inspection: Regularly observe whether there is any fuel leakage on the surface of the pump body (high-pressure leakage may be accompanied by a "hissing" sound). Stop the machine immediately for maintenance if any abnormality is found.
Response to Extreme environments
High-sulfur fuel: Add Perkins anti-sulfur additive (P-0035) every 1000 hours to neutralize H₂S in the fuel and delay the corrosion of the plunger pair.
In low-temperature areas: In winter, use diesel with a low pour point of -40 ℃. Before starting, let the engine idle for 5 minutes to preheat the oil pump to prevent the plunger from getting stuck due to fuel waxing.
